Chip-Maker Nvidia Becomes World's Most Valuable Company



In a landmark achievement, Nvidia has become the world’s most valuable company, surpassing tech giants like Apple and Microsoft.

Nvidia’s stock price surged yesterday (18), pushing its market capitalization to an unprecedented $3.34 trillion.

The stock ended the trading day at nearly $136, up 3.5%, making Nvidia more valuable than Microsoft.
